Bug description:
  There is no package with debug symbols for coreutils (e.g. /bin/ls),
  nether a *-dbg nor a *-dbgsym version on http://ddebs.ubuntu.com.
  Coreutils is one very important package and should have either debug
  symbols not stripped out or debug symbols provided in external
  package.
  I am running a Maverick 10.10 here.
  apt-cache policy coreutils 
  coreutils:
    Installed: 8.5-1ubuntu3
    Candidate: 8.5-1ubuntu3
  I expected to find a package named coreutils-dbg or coreutils-dbgsym.
  Instead no such package was found
